Meeting Summary
The Providence City Council meeting on 2026-07-16 was primarily ceremonial and procedural, with most substantive land-use and fiscal items waived, referred to committee, or honorary resolutions.
Key Decisions (8)
Second passage of items 7 through 15 (including PPSD procurement ordinance and affordable-housing tax ordinances)
Ceremonial renaming of Fisk Street honoring Roberto Gonzalez (items 16 through 21)
Resolutions honoring Cabo Verde Blue Sharks and supporting resident physicians (items 22 and 23)
